Hammer or hammer weight? The weight will slide out after removing the adjuster. The hammer does not.
 
Hammer weight, I bought a 14g weight to replace the oem weight. My gun has the thin power wheel with 1-2-3 dots.
So to exchange the weight I remove the small screw on the right side of the gun and pull the power wheel out on the left side?
Feels like it has a spring loaded detent when turning the wheel, does it fall out?

To remove hammer (with hammer weight), You need to remove trigger assembly. Trigger sear wont let hammer to slide out. Hammer weight can be changed without getting hammer out.

So I removed the hammer weight today, it follows the spring out and doesn't require removing the trigger.
The original hammer weight is about 11.5grams, the heavier one is 13.8. I installed it and tried some different tensions all the way to maxed out but all the velocities were lower with it installed, the best speeds are with the Huma heavy spring and original hammer weight,

So I kept the original Hammer weight and just added a heavier duty spring, it's a simple matter of unscrewing that piece out of the back of the action and letting the hammer/spring fall out, I bought an additional piece and I don't remember where I got it I think it was off of eBay that goes in behind the threaded piece that captures the spring and Hammer it locks it in place
